Re: OpenTX 2.1 telemetry system preview
Just connect the sensor and power up model and radio, its fields will be detected, then edit the altitude one to turn on Auto Offset and create a new Calculated sensor with formula Distance and selecting the GPS as the source. If you also select an alt source you get 3D distance, otherwise 2D.

Re: OpenTX 2.1 telemetry system preview
Nothing. It adds / multiplies all the items you give in the sources.Julez wrote: 1) When I choose "Add" or "Multiply", what is the base value the telemety value is added to or multiplied with?
Yep.Julez wrote: 2) Does the precision number indicate the decimal places behind the dot?
Offset adds a constant to the value. Auto Offset stores the first received value after a reset as zero (i.e. for altitude for example).Julez wrote: 3) What is the difference between "offset" and "auto offset", and what does each do?
Can make a jumpy value less jumpy.Julez wrote: 4) How do I determine when to apply the "filter" function?
Like for the timers, value gets stored at power off and recalled next time (can be useful for mAh or fuel totalizer for example)Julez wrote: 5) What does "Persistent" mean?
A mess right now, at this point it's the same as the old Range setting for A1 and A2. That will change in future 2.1 releases.Julez wrote: 6) What does "Gewichtung" (weight?) mean?

Re: OpenTX 2.1 telemetry system preview
Just clamps any negative value to 0. I still don't know why that was added, but it wasn't my call...
